Funke Akindele returns to Celestial Church, seeks prayer for political aspiration

Actress Funke Akindele, Deputy governorship candidate of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) in Lagos State has returned to Celestial Church to seek for prayers over her political ambition.

Earlier in the year immediately after her emergence as the running mate to Jide Adeniran, the governorship candidate of the party, Akindele attended a revival programme of the church in what many pundits described as vote seeking tactics.

She then said she decided to return to the church where she was born and dedicated after many years.

At Imeko in Ogun State which is the spiritual headquarters of Celestial Church Worldwide, Akindele was spotted over the weekend at the annual gathering of the faithful in fulfilment of her promise to full membership.

Addressing the crowd in a video posted on social media, the depity governorship candidate pleaded with the members and church elders to pray for her, adding that she is putting God first in her undertakings.

She said in the video: “Anything we do we must put God first. We have to be well mannered. We must behave like those who wear white clothes. We have to behave like a ‘Celestial’ member.

“We must not forget our source. Don’t forget your God. God be with you. All I want is prayer. Keep praying for me.”
